    Text: CERAMIC CHIP / HIGH VOLTAGE KEMET's High Voltage Surface Mount Capacitors are designed to withstand high voltage applications. They offer high capacitance with low leakage current and low ESR at high frequency. The capacitors have pure tin Sn plated external electrodes for good solderability. X7R dielectrics are not designed for AC line filtering
